William Gerald Green
December 20, 1942 - April 25, 2022

William Gerald Green, age 79 of Union City, passed away Monday, April 25, 2022 at The Waters.

Funeral service will be held at 11AM Wednesday, April 27, 2022 at White-Ranson Funeral Home with Bro. Terry Neil and Bro. Melvin Poe officiating. Burial will follow in New Haven Cemetery in Ridgely. Visitation will be from 4PM-7PM Tuesday, April 26, 2022 and again before the funeral on Wednesday beginning at 10AM and running until the time of service at the funeral home.

Family and friends will serve as pallbearers.

Mr. Green was born in East Prairie on December 20, 1942 to the late William Turner and Alta Lorene Castleman Green. He married Betty Joyner Green on October 13, 2007. She survives. He was retired from Kohler. Mr. Green was also the founder and organizer of the Roundhouse Reunion that was held at Reelfoot Lake annually for 30+ years.

In addition to his wife, he is survived by one son, James Glenn Green of Union City; five grandchildren, Jack Logan Cord Hastings, Kristyn Shai Nicole Hastings, Kyndal Brooke Ashlyn Hastings, April Denise Brooks and William Patrick Brooks; one great-grandchild, Carson Bentley Levi Fulcher; one son-in-law, Richard Lee Brooks of Union City; and two sisters, Patricia Jowers and her husband Jimmy of Friendship and Devenda Summers of Union City.

Along with his parents, Mr. Green was preceded in death by his first wife, Villa B. Williams Green; his daughter, Angela Faye Brooks; two brothers, J.W. and Dwight Green; and one sister, Wanda Nichols.
